New leaders often feel the pressure to have all the answers. Take my client Felix, a newly promoted manager. Up until his recent promotion, he had always served as a subject matter expert who was responsible for one or two projects. His reliability and skill earned him a leadership role where he was overseeing many projects and people all at once.
